Top Platforms Offering ScreenwritingCourses

With a growing demand for accessible education, several respected platforms now offer screenwritingCourses. Some notable options include:

  • MasterClass: Featuring courses from renowned screenwriters like Shonda Rhimes and Aaron Sorkin, MasterClass blends storytelling insights with practical advice.
  • Coursera: Provides a variety of university-affiliated screenwritingCourses, often including certification.
  • Udemy: Offers affordable options for beginners and intermediate learners, with courses covering everything from basics to advanced techniques.
  • The Writers’ Store: Specializes in screenwriting tools and workshops tailored to different experience levels.

Before enrolling, review the course curriculum, instructor credentials, and student reviews to ensure the program matches your goals.

How to Get the Most Out of Your ScreenwritingCourses

To fully benefit from screenwritingCourses, consider the following tips:

  1. Commit to Regular Practice: Screenwriting is a skill honed over time, so allocate dedicated time to write consistently.
  2. Engage with the Community: Participate actively in forums or group discussions to exchange ideas and feedback.
  3. Apply Lessons Immediately: Implement feedback on your scripts and revise often to see real improvement.
  4. Watch Films Critically: Analyze movies in your genre, noting structure, pacing, and character development.
  5. Network with Industry Professionals: Use course connections to build relationships that may open doors in Hollywood or independent film circuits.

FAQ About ScreenwritingCourses

Q1: What are the best screenwritingCourses for beginners?
A1: Beginners should look for courses that cover screenplay basics, such as formatting and story structure. Platforms like Udemy and Coursera offer beginner-friendly courses that are affordable and comprehensive.

Q2: Can screenwritingCourses help me get a screenplay produced?
A2: While screenwritingCourses give you the skills and knowledge to write professional scripts, getting a screenplay produced often requires additional efforts like networking, pitching, and sometimes representation by agents or managers.

Q3: Are online screenwritingCourses as effective as in-person classes?
A3: Yes, many online screenwritingCourses offer interactive lessons, live feedback, and community support comparable to in-person classes. They also provide flexibility for busy learners and access to industry professionals worldwide.
